In "no-fault" states, vehicle drivers should purchase injury protection (PIP) coverage, which generally covers clinical bills and shed salaries approximately the policy restriction. Nevertheless, it usually does not spend for discomfort and suffering and typically doesn't cover all clinical bills and Cyclist Fatality lost salaries, Matthews writes.

When the authorities get to the mishap scene, they will initially make certain everyone is risk-free. Then, they might need to redirect web traffic, take images, and perhaps provide citations. Before they leave, they will produce a police report that includes details regarding the celebrations involved in the crash, the time and area, and a summary of physical injuries. A cars and truck accident trial usually just lasts one or two days, though there is no policy on how much time it can take. These situations might be listened to by a single judge, referred to as a bench test, or might be tried prior to a jury. Some states require a court test be asked for at the time the first lawsuit issue is filed. As soon as all the evidence is presented the jury or court makes a resolution in the event.
